Few Monopoly GO moments feel worse than returning to a board full of damaged landmarks after a solid cash-building session. They activate automatically during a Shutdown, so there is no button to press when another player targets your board.

Shields matter most when your board is expensive

Early on, losing a landmark can feel like a minor annoyance because repairs are affordable. That changes fast once your board costs climb. A few damaged landmarks can drain the cash you meant to spend on finishing a board, slowing both progression and event scoring. Shields do not stop players from selecting you as a target, but they prevent the landmark damage that follows. Think of them as saved cash rather than just a defensive icon. A full shield supply gives you more freedom to leave the game after making upgrades instead of worrying that your work will be undone.

Pick them up while pursuing real rewards

The reliable source is landing on shield spaces as you move around the board. Their position changes from board to board, so watch the spaces ahead before raising your roll multiplier. If a shield is a few tiles away and an event pickup is also nearby, a higher multiplier can make sense. If it is on the far side of the board with no other value around it, chasing it can burn dice for little return. Quick Wins and limited-time reward tracks can also contribute useful resources while you play normally. The efficient approach is to collect shields as part of your event grind, not to make them the only reason for rolling.

Don't treat a full meter as a reason to spend carelessly

Shield storage has a cap, so repeatedly landing on shield spaces while already full is rarely the best use of dice. Newer players often empty their dice supply trying to refill immediately after one successful defense. That habit hurts more than the occasional repair bill. Instead, rebuild your supply during normal play, then pause on a comfortable amount when there is no worthwhile event running. Before a big upgrade push, check your shield count first. Completing several landmarks with no protection left creates an awkward window where every Shutdown feels costly.

Build a routine around your active sessions

When you have time to play, finish Quick Wins, watch for shield spaces during useful rolls, and spend cash on landmarks with a plan rather than leaving many partially repaired targets. During competitive events, keeping a few shields ready is usually smarter than forcing every last roll into a milestone. Monopoly GO rewards players who protect their cash flow as carefully as their dice supply.
